How to troubleshoot failing caller ID display in VoIP systems caused by SIP header manipulation and carrier settings.
A practical, evergreen guide explains why caller ID might fail in VoIP, outlines common SIP header manipulations, carrier-specific quirks, and step-by-step checks to restore accurate caller identification.
Published August 06, 2025
Facebook X Reddit Pinterest Email
In many VoIP setups, caller ID failure traces back to how signaling headers are formed and processed. SIP headers carry the essential fields that identify the calling party, and any mismatch between what the network expects and what the endpoint presents can show a blank, a wrong name, or an anonymous label. Providers often apply normalization rules that strip or rewrite headers, which can inadvertently disguise the source number. Troubleshooting starts with a controlled environment: verify that the originating device or gateway is sending a consistent From header, check the P-Asserted-Identity and Remote-Party-ID fields, and confirm alignment with the carrier’s requirements. Understanding these headers helps isolate where the display mismatch originates.
Begin by capturing a clean SIP trace that spans from the handset or gateway to the downstream carrier. Look for From, To, Contact, P-Asserted-Identity, and Remote-Party-ID values and note any discrepancies between them. Differences may appear after network hops where carriers apply translation rules. If the P-Asserted-Identity is present, ensure it matches the intended caller, and assess whether the Remote-Party-ID is being rewritten by intermediate devices. Documenting these details creates a baseline and helps distinguish user-side misconfigurations from carrier-side modifications. A well-documented trace accelerates communication with both IT staff and service providers.
Carrier policies and header integrity must align for reliable display
Once headers are inspected, examine configuration on the SIP trunk and session border controller for header manipulation policies. Many systems offer options to rewrite or strip P-Asserted-Identity or Remote-Party-ID for compliance or privacy. If these settings are enabled, they may override the caller’s true identity and cause mismatches at the recipient’s caller ID display. Adjust rules to preserve legitimate identity fields while respecting privacy or regulatory constraints. After changing policies, re-run a trace to confirm that the intended numbers appear consistently across calls. This iterative approach reduces back-and-forth with carriers.
ADVERTISEMENT
ADVERTISEMENT
In parallel, assess how the carrier handles numeric presentation and normalization. Carriers sometimes apply filters that convert international numbers or short dialed strings into anonymous or restricted formats. Confirm the subscriber’s profile on the carrier side, especially any features that suppress caller ID by default or override it with a business or line-label. If misalignment is found, request a carrier engineering review or a temporary exemption to test whether preserving the original header data resolves the issue. Always corroborate results with test calls from different regions to rule out locale-specific effects.
End-user and device settings should align with network policies
A robust practice is to establish a standard naming convention for outbound calls. Agree on whether the From header, P-Asserted-Identity, or Remote-Party-ID should carry the canonical number and display name. When possible, keep these fields consistent across all routes to minimize surprises at the receiving end. If a trunk has multiple routes, ensure each route adheres to the same policy. Inconsistent routing can cause some paths to honor identity data while others do not, leading to intermittent display issues. A unified approach reduces variability and improves predictability for end users.
ADVERTISEMENT
ADVERTISEMENT
Another critical area is device and end-user configuration. Some endpoints allow users to set a display name that overwrites system-provided identity, while others strictly rely on network-supplied data. Disable user-entered overrides that conflict with trunk-level policies, or implement a centralized profile that enforces uniform display information. Regular audits of device configurations help maintain consistency as devices are added or updated. After implementing these controls, perform a staggered rollout with a few test numbers to ensure that changes propagate as intended before wider deployment.
Privacy rules and regulatory constraints can shape identity visibility
When tests reveal intermittent issues, test across multiple carriers and regions. If one carrier consistently displays correctly while another does not, it points to carrier-specific rules rather than local configurations. Engage with the affected carrier’s technical support to request logs or a policy review that explains any systematic alterations to identity data. In some cases, a formal service request or escalation may be required. Document the outcomes of each carrier interaction, as this record becomes a useful reference for future troubleshooting and for training staff to handle similar problems efficiently.
Consider the impact of privacy and regulatory constraints on identity data. Some jurisdictions limit the visibility of caller information to protect privacy, which can manifest as blank or masked identifiers. Review compliance requirements and any service-level agreements that define how identity data should be presented. If legitimate privacy settings are in force, determine whether a workaround exists that preserves the caller’s identity without breaching policy. A careful balance between transparency for recipients and compliance safeguards long-term reliability of caller ID displays across networks.
ADVERTISEMENT
ADVERTISEMENT
Structured testing and policy enforcement sustain caller ID accuracy
Advanced testing should include synthetic calls that mirror real traffic, using controlled identities that you own. Engineers can simulate different scenarios, such as clean From headers versus headers with partial identity, to observe how each route handles display. This method helps uncover subtle quirks that may escape casual testing. Maintain a test log that records the exact header values, the route, and the resulting display observed by the recipient. With a clear dataset, you can reproduce issues quickly and validate fixes without relying on live customer calls.
After each testing cycle, implement the corrective action in a staged manner. Begin with the trunk or gateway policy, then extend to downstream routes, and finally confirm with multiple handsets or soft clients. Monitor for regression by comparing new traces with the baseline. If a problem recurs, revisit the identity fields that carry the user-visible name and number, ensuring no conflicting rewrite rules exist. Regularly refreshing the test matrix keeps the system aligned with evolving carrier rules and keeps caller ID reliable for users.
To solidify gains, document a policy playbook that outlines approved header configurations and carrier-specific notes. This living document should include default values for P-Asserted-Identity and Remote-Party-ID, plus any exceptions, so new deployments quickly align with established standards. Include rollback steps in case a carrier or device update disrupts identity data. Training for technicians should emphasize how to read SIP traces, interpret header fields, and communicate findings to providers. The clearer the playbook, the less time is wasted diagnosing recurring issues and the faster caller ID can be restored.
Finally, foster ongoing collaboration across IT, network services, and carriers. Establish a quarterly review of identity handling across all routes, including a checklist for header integrity and display tests. Sharing anonymized trace samples accelerates problem solving and helps partners learn from real scenarios. By maintaining visibility into header behavior and carrier requirements, teams can anticipate changes, prevent regressions, and ensure end users consistently see accurate caller IDs across a complex VoIP landscape.
Related Articles
Common issues & fixes
When migrations fail, the resulting inconsistent schema can cripple features, degrade performance, and complicate future deployments. This evergreen guide outlines practical, stepwise methods to recover, stabilize, and revalidate a database after a failed migration, reducing risk of data loss and future surprises.
-
July 30, 2025
Common issues & fixes
When a site serves mixed or incomplete SSL chains, browsers can warn or block access, undermining security and trust. This guide explains practical steps to diagnose, repair, and verify consistent certificate chains across servers, CDNs, and clients.
-
July 23, 2025
Common issues & fixes
When APIs respond slowly, the root causes often lie in inefficient database queries and missing caching layers. This guide walks through practical, repeatable steps to diagnose, optimize, and stabilize API performance without disruptive rewrites or brittle fixes.
-
August 12, 2025
Common issues & fixes
When a firmware upgrade goes wrong, many IoT devices refuse to boot, leaving users confused and frustrated. This evergreen guide explains practical, safe recovery steps, troubleshooting, and preventive practices to restore functionality without risking further damage.
-
July 19, 2025
Common issues & fixes
When replication stalls or diverges, teams must diagnose network delays, schema drift, and transaction conflicts, then apply consistent, tested remediation steps to restore data harmony between primary and replica instances.
-
August 02, 2025
Common issues & fixes
When system updates stall during installation, the culprit often lies in preinstall or postinstall scripts. This evergreen guide explains practical steps to isolate, diagnose, and fix script-related hangs without destabilizing your environment.
-
July 28, 2025
Common issues & fixes
An in-depth, practical guide to diagnosing, repairing, and stabilizing image optimization pipelines that unexpectedly generate oversized assets after processing hiccups, with reproducible steps for engineers and operators.
-
August 08, 2025
Common issues & fixes
When a zip file refuses to open or errors during extraction, the central directory may be corrupted, resulting in unreadable archives. This guide explores practical, reliable steps to recover data, minimize loss, and prevent future damage.
-
July 16, 2025
Common issues & fixes
Slow uploads to cloud backups can be maddening, but practical steps, configuration checks, and smarter routing can greatly improve performance without costly upgrades or third-party tools.
-
August 07, 2025
Common issues & fixes
Discover reliable methods to standardize EXIF metadata when switching between editors, preventing drift in dates, GPS information, and camera models while preserving image quality and workflow efficiency.
-
July 15, 2025
Common issues & fixes
A practical, step by step guide to diagnosing notification failures across channels, focusing on queue ordering, concurrency constraints, and reliable fixes that prevent sporadic delivery gaps.
-
August 09, 2025
Common issues & fixes
This evergreen guide explains practical, step-by-step approaches to diagnose corrupted firmware, recover devices, and reapply clean factory images without risking permanent damage or data loss, using cautious, documented methods.
-
July 30, 2025
Common issues & fixes
When software updates install localized packs that misalign, users may encounter unreadable menus, corrupted phrases, and jumbled characters; this evergreen guide explains practical steps to restore clarity, preserve translations, and prevent recurrence across devices and environments.
-
July 24, 2025
Common issues & fixes
When servers send unexpected content because clients neglect accept headers, developers must diagnose negotiation logic, enforce proper client signaling, and implement robust fallback behavior to ensure correct representations are delivered every time.
-
August 07, 2025
Common issues & fixes
When emails reveal garbled headers, steps from diagnosis to practical fixes ensure consistent rendering across diverse mail apps, improving deliverability, readability, and user trust for everyday communicators.
-
August 07, 2025
Common issues & fixes
When legitimate messages are mislabeled as spam, the root causes often lie in DNS alignment, authentication failures, and policy decisions. Understanding how DKIM, SPF, and DMARC interact helps you diagnose issues, adjust records, and improve deliverability without compromising security. This guide provides practical steps to identify misconfigurations, test configurations, and verify end-to-end mail flow across common platforms and servers.
-
July 23, 2025
Common issues & fixes
When credentials fail to authenticate consistently for FTP or SFTP, root causes span server-side policy changes, client misconfigurations, and hidden account restrictions; this guide outlines reliable steps to diagnose, verify, and correct mismatched credentials across both protocols.
-
August 08, 2025
Common issues & fixes
When email clients insist on asking for passwords again and again, the underlying causes often lie in credential stores or keychain misconfigurations, which disrupt authentication and trigger continual password prompts.
-
August 03, 2025
Common issues & fixes
A practical, step-by-step guide to resolving frequent Linux filesystem read-only states caused by improper shutdowns or disk integrity problems, with safe, proven methods for diagnosing, repairing, and preventing future occurrences.
-
July 23, 2025
Common issues & fixes
This evergreen guide explains practical steps to diagnose and fix scheduled task failures when daylight saving changes disrupt timing and when non portable cron entries complicate reliability across systems, with safe, repeatable methods.
-
July 23, 2025